Jefferson County Sheriff’s Office says driver, Alan “Haley” Mills intentionally struck 2 cyclists, critically injuring 1

Authorities issued a Medina Alert after the Jefferson County Sheriff’s Office said a driver of an SUV intentionally struck two cyclists, critically injuring one Sunday. The crash occurred around 9:45 a.m. on Hwy 40 between the Evergreen Parkway and Interstate 70 in Jefferson County. The sheriff’s office said the driver of a 2018 grey Ford Escape intentionally struck the two cyclists and then took off. One of the two victims is in critical condition, the ... Read more

New Mountain Bike Venue in Colorado Springs Set to Take Shape

A new mountain bike venue is set to take shape in the coming weeks on Colorado Springs’ southwest side. -By Seth Boster–The Gazette Planners expect construction to start in early June on a dirt pump track and “skills trail” occupying a 1 1/2-acre corner of Cresta Open Space, between Cheyenne Mountain High School and Skyway Elementary. The pump track’s rollers and berms are projected to span 765 linear feet, while the skills trail is envisioned ... Read more

Man arrested in 100+ bike thefts in Aurora, Colorado

Alec Jackson was arrested after he was spotted by community members who held him down until officers arrived on scene, police said. The Aurora Police Department (APD) said they arrested a man last week whom they think is responsible for more than 100 bicycle thefts, many of them at Stanley Marketplace. Alec Jackson, 27, was arrested May 5 at Stanley Marketplace, 2501 Dallas St., after community members spotted him “trying to victimize again,” according to APD. The community ... Read more
